Seven Species, Seven Superpowers
There are exactly seven living species of sea turtles in the world — no more, no less. Each has its own special traits, habitat, and survival story. Scientists classify them by shell shape, diet, size, and where they live. The largest is the leatherback (Dermochelys coriacea), which can weigh up to 2,000 pounds — that’s like two adult grizzly bears! The smallest is the Kemp’s ridley (Lepidochelys kempii), averaging just 80–100 pounds and 2 feet long. Olive ridleys and Kemp’s ridleys are famous for their ‘arribadas’ — mass nesting events where thousands of females come ashore together. In 2023, researchers at the Padre Island National Seashore in Texas recorded 18,742 Kemp’s ridley nests — the highest number since record-keeping began in 1980.
Meet the Seven
- Leatherback: No hard shell — instead, a leathery, rubbery carapace with 7 ridges; dives deeper than any turtle (4,000+ feet); eats only jellyfish.
- Green turtle: Named for green fat (not shell color); adults graze on seagrass beds — vital for healthy oceans; found in warm waters worldwide.
- Hawksbill: Pointed beak like a bird’s; feeds on sponges in coral reefs; critically endangered due to illegal tortoiseshell trade.
- Loggerhead: Massive head and jaw muscles; crushes clams and conchs; nests mostly on U.S. Atlantic and Gulf coasts.
- Kemp’s ridley: Only sea turtle that nests mostly during daylight; nests almost exclusively in Mexico and Texas.
- Olive ridley: Smallest hard-shelled species; known for synchronized arribadas in India, Costa Rica, and Mexico.
- Flatback: Found only in Australian waters; flat shell helps it navigate shallow coastal reefs and muddy estuaries.
None of these turtles can retract their heads or flippers into their shells like land turtles — they’re built for speed and endurance, not hiding. Their streamlined bodies and powerful front flippers act like wings, letting them glide through water with minimal effort.
How Sea Turtles Navigate Across Oceans
Imagine swimming across an entire ocean — without maps, phones, or GPS satellites. Sea turtles do it every day! Hatchlings emerge from nests on beaches like those in Florida’s Archie Carr National Wildlife Refuge and immediately head toward the sea. Within hours, they begin a journey that may span thousands of miles. How do they find their way? They use Earth’s magnetic field — like an invisible compass inside their brains. Researchers at the University of North Carolina discovered tiny magnetic crystals (magnetite) in sea turtle brains, especially near the trigeminal nerve. These crystals respond to magnetic fields the same way a compass needle does.
Magnetic Maps and Memory
Scientists tested this by placing hatchlings in tanks with artificial magnetic fields matching locations 1,000 miles north and south of their home beach. The babies consistently swam in directions matching the real-world geography — proving they’re born with a built-in navigation system. Adult females return to the *exact same beach* where they hatched — sometimes after 30 years and 10,000-mile round trips. This behavior is called natal homing. Satellite tracking by NOAA Fisheries shows loggerheads tagged off Cape Hatteras, North Carolina, migrating to feeding grounds near the Azores (2,200 miles away) and back — all guided by magnetic signatures unique to each coastline.
This incredible ability is fragile. Human-made electromagnetic noise — like undersea power cables or sonar systems — can interfere with magnetic sensing. That’s why the International Maritime Organization now recommends shielding new offshore energy infrastructure near key nesting zones like the Great Barrier Reef and the coast of Oman.
Baby Turtles: From Nest to Ocean
A sea turtle’s life starts buried in warm sand. A mother green turtle digs a nest about 18–22 inches deep using her rear flippers — a process that takes 1–2 hours and leaves a mound shaped like a volcano. She lays 100–120 ping-pong-sized eggs (each roughly 1.5 inches wide and weighing about 40 grams — similar to a large walnut). Then she covers the nest and returns to the sea, never seeing her babies again.
Inside the egg, development depends heavily on temperature. If sand stays between 82–86°F (28–30°C), you’ll get a mix of males and females. Warmer nests (above 86°F) produce mostly females; cooler ones (below 82°F) yield mostly males. Climate change is shifting this balance — in Florida’s most active nesting region, 90% of hatchlings were female in 2022, according to data from the Florida Fish and Wildlife Conservation Commission. Too many females mean fewer babies in future generations.
Hatchling Survival Challenges
After 45–70 days, hatchlings break out of their shells using a temporary tooth called a caruncle. They dig upward as a group — a behavior called ‘social facilitation’ — which helps them conserve energy. Once at the surface, they wait until nightfall, then dash to the water in a coordinated sprint. But danger waits everywhere: raccoons, ghost crabs, birds, and even curious humans. Only about 1 in 1,000 hatchlings survives to adulthood. That’s why conservation groups like the Loggerhead Marinelife Center in Juno Beach, FL, run nightly beach patrols — recording nest locations, installing predator cages, and relocating vulnerable nests to safer, cooler spots.
In 2023, volunteers monitored over 12,000 nests along Florida’s east coast alone. Thanks to these efforts, hatchling success rates rose from 57% to 72% in protected areas — showing how hands-on care makes a real difference.
What Sea Turtles Eat (and Why It Matters)
Sea turtles are nature’s cleanup crew — and gardeners! Their diets vary by species and age. Baby loggerheads and greens eat crabs, shrimp, and jellyfish. But adult greens switch to 100% plant-based meals: seagrass and algae. In fact, a single adult green turtle grazes up to 2 tons of seagrass per year — helping keep meadows healthy and productive. Healthy seagrass absorbs carbon dioxide at rates 35 times faster than rainforests, according to research published in Nature Communications (2021).
Hawksbills are coral reef specialists. They eat sponges — some of which grow so fast they smother coral. By eating up to 1,000 pounds of sponge per year, hawksbills protect reef biodiversity. Leatherbacks, meanwhile, feast almost exclusively on jellyfish — up to 16,000 pounds annually. That’s equal to 400 average-sized jellyfish every day!

Super Anatomy: Built for Life at Sea
Sea turtles aren’t just adapted to the ocean — they’re engineered for it. Their front flippers are long, stiff, and paddle-shaped — perfect for powerful strokes. Leatherbacks have the longest flippers of any turtle: up to 8.5 feet tip-to-tip on a 6-foot adult. Their bones are dense but lightweight, and their lungs are specially designed to collapse under pressure — allowing deep dives without getting ‘the bends.’
They can hold their breath for up to 7 hours while resting — but only 5–10 minutes when swimming hard. Unlike fish, sea turtles must surface to breathe air. They have salt-excreting glands behind their eyes — the ‘tears’ you see when they’re on land. Those tears aren’t sadness — they’re nature’s desalination plant! Each drop contains up to 35 grams of salt per liter — nearly twice as salty as seawater — helping them stay hydrated while eating salty prey.

Sea turtles also have excellent vision underwater — thanks to a special layer behind their retinas called the tapetum lucidum (the same reflective layer cats and deer use to see in low light). But they’re nearsighted on land — which is why they rely so much on smell and magnetism to navigate beaches.
